Transaction ad8f66fe14ebd9004c5540f598bdb3141561bf98201516e840839cee20fb626f
1 Input
1 Output
-
ad8f66fe14ebd9004c5540f598bdb3141561bf98201516e840839cee20fb626f:0
- value
- 413203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cd2c03f9a88c7c3955f1807638ff6c4ef9a6bcf OP_EQUAL
- address
- 3JuRRqnoKMxVSkLswFazLN9fgF4cJTXWeg